Miles Overview
The 2015 Passat is VW's mid-size sedan, the one that gives you a big back seat and trunk without moving up to a full-size car. On the road it feels planted and stable, and the steering is smooth and direct, making highway miles easy. The ride is comfortable and quiet, and the front seats have good lumbar support, which helps on long trips. Inside, the cabin is roomy, with a spacious back seat and a large trunk, though the front seats could be a bit wider. The TDI SEL Premium is the diesel choice for the Passat, giving you the same generous rear legroom as the gas SEL Premium but with a different engine character. Its 2.0L I4 makes 150 horsepower and 236 lb-ft of torque, and the six-speed automatic keeps it in the sweet spot for effortless highway cruising at 44 mpg highway. This trim adds leather upholstery and a sunroof, and the diesel's long range means fewer stops on road trips.
